What is an SVG File?
SVG stands for Scalable Vector Graphic. It's an image format that allows you to scale the vector elements infinitely without losing any quality. An SVG file is generally used for printing, web graphics, and icons.

- An SVG file, or scalable vector graphic, is a digital image format that uses mathematical equations to create lines, shapes, and curves. This means that the image can be scaled up or down without losing quality.
- You can use an SVG file for a variety of projects, such as creating t-shirts, decals, or wall art. The file can be opened in programs like Adobe Illustrator, Inkscape, or even Silhouette Studio.
